Understanding the Technology Behind LED Performance

Before diving into supplier evaluation, it's essential to grasp the fundamental technology driving modern lighting solutions. So how do leds work exactly? Unlike traditional incandescent bulbs that use filaments or fluorescent tubes that rely on gas excitation, Light Emitting Diodes (LEDs) operate through electroluminescence - a process where electrons moving through a semiconductor material release energy in the form of photons (light). This fundamental difference explains why LEDs consume significantly less energy while producing minimal heat compared to conventional lighting technologies.

The efficiency of LED technology becomes particularly evident in commercial applications. According to the Illuminating Engineering Society (IES), high-quality LED flood lights can deliver 80-100 lumens per watt, compared to just 10-17 lumens per watt for traditional halogen flood lights. This efficiency translates directly to operational cost savings, but only when the LED technology is properly implemented with adequate thermal management and quality components.

Critical Factors in LED Flood Light Supplier Evaluation

Selecting the right led flood light supplier involves more than comparing price points. Reputable suppliers distinguish themselves through transparent technical documentation, manufacturing capabilities, and post-sale support systems. The International Association of Lighting Designers (IALD) emphasizes that commercial buyers should prioritize suppliers who provide detailed photometric data, independent testing reports, and clear warranty terms.

When evaluating potential partners for wholesale led flood lights, consider these essential factors:

  • Manufacturing certifications (ISO 9001, ISO 14001)
  • In-house research and development capabilities
  • Quality control processes throughout production
  • Technical support availability and response times
  • Inventory management and delivery reliability
  • References from similar commercial projects

Many successful commercial lighting projects utilize a phased procurement approach, beginning with sample testing before committing to large orders. This strategy allows facilities managers to verify performance claims under actual operating conditions and assess the supplier's responsiveness to technical inquiries.

Common Pitfalls in Wholesale LED Procurement

The attraction of lower pricing through wholesale led flood lights purchases can sometimes obscure critical quality considerations. Industry data from the Commercial Building Energy Consumption Survey indicates that nearly 40% of businesses report dissatisfaction with their initial LED lighting installations, primarily due to unexpected performance issues or premature failures.

Common risks when selecting an led flood light supplier include:

  1. Inconsistent product quality across batches
  2. Inadequate technical documentation for proper installation
  3. Limited after-sales support and extended response times
  4. Complicated warranty claim processes
  5. Inaccurate performance data in product specifications
  6. Insufficient inventory leading to project delays

Understanding how do leds work at a technical level helps buyers ask the right questions during supplier evaluations. For instance, inquiries about binning processes (color consistency), driver specifications, and thermal management designs can reveal a supplier's attention to quality details that impact long-term performance.

Strategic Sourcing Approaches for Commercial Projects

Successful commercial lighting projects typically involve a multi-tiered supplier evaluation process that balances technical requirements with commercial considerations. The DesignLights Consortium (DLC) recommends that commercial buyers establish minimum performance thresholds before beginning the supplier selection process, ensuring that all considered products meet baseline quality standards.

When sourcing wholesale led flood lights for large-scale implementations, consider these strategic approaches:

  • Develop a supplier scorecard with weighted criteria (technical performance 40%, commercial terms 30%, support capabilities 30%)
  • Request sample units for independent testing before bulk ordering
  • Verify supplier certifications through third-party databases
  • Conduct site visits to manufacturing facilities when possible
  • Establish clear communication protocols for technical support
  • Negotiate service level agreements for after-sales support

Maximizing Return on Lighting Investments

The ultimate goal of thorough supplier evaluation is to ensure commercial lighting projects deliver expected performance and return on investment. According to analysis by the Lawrence Berkeley National Laboratory, properly executed LED retrofits in commercial properties typically achieve payback periods of 2-4 years through energy savings and reduced maintenance costs.

When working with a led flood light supplier for wholesale led flood lights, focus on total cost of ownership rather than just initial purchase price. Consider these financial aspects:

  • Energy consumption calculations based on actual usage patterns
  • Maintenance cost projections including replacement labor
  • Warranty coverage and expected product lifespan
  • Potential utility rebates for high-efficiency installations
  • Compatibility with lighting control systems for additional savings
